Riemann surfaces with nodes and minimal surfaces without symmetries.
The classical Weierstrass Representation provides a strong connection between minimal surfaces ( or soap-film surfaces ) and complex analysis. All classical examples of minimal surfaces are quite symmetric, in particular they are hyperelliptic. We will see how to use Riemann surfaces with nodes to construct minimal surfaces without symmetries.


Martin Traizet
Universite de Tours, France
